c語言計算分段函數絕對值 計算某數的絕對值c語言

C語言題求解。計算絕對值函數。 (if語句)?

#include stdio.h

成都創新互聯公司是專業的薌城網站建設公司,薌城接單;提供成都網站制作、網站建設、外貿網站建設,網頁設計,網站設計,建網站,PHP網站建設等專業做網站服務;采用PHP框架,可快速的進行薌城網站開發網頁制作和功能擴展;專業做搜索引擎喜愛的網站,專業的做網站團隊,希望更多企業前來合作!

int main()

{

int a;

scanf("%d",a);

if(a0)

? a=-a;

printf("%d\n",a);

return 0;

}

C語言中如何求絕對值

//求絕對值

#include iostream

#include iomanip

#includecmath

#define PI 3.1415927

using namespace std;

int main()

{? ?//C++求絕對值:如果是整形的,就是abs(),如果是浮點型的,是fabs()

double r;

while(cinr){

coutsetprecision(2)std::fixedfabs(r)endl;

}

return 0;

}

擴展資料:

c語言中取絕對值的函數

不同類型的數據使用不同類型的絕對值函數:

1、整型:

int abs(int i) ?//返回整型參數i的絕對值 12

2、復數:

double cabs(struct complex znum) ?//返回復數znum的絕對值 ?1

3、雙精度浮點型:

double fabs(double x) ?//返回雙精度參數x的絕對值 ? ?1

4、長整型:

long labs(long n) ?//返回長整型參數n的絕對值

C語言求絕對值

有。C語言求絕對值的函數為abs( x )與fbs( x ),abs( x )包含于stdlib.h,且兩者均包含于math頭文件之下。

1、abs( x )函數

格式:int abs( int i );

作用:求整型數的絕對值

例子:

#includestdio.h

#include stdlib.h

#includemath.h

main(? ?)

{

int a = 1, b = -2 ;

printf("%d的絕對值是%d,%d的絕對值是%d\n", a, abs( a ), b, abs( b ));

}

運行結果為:1的絕對值是1,-2的絕對值是2

2、fabs( x )函數

格式:float fabs( float i ); / double fabs( double x );

作用:求浮點數的絕對值

例子:

#includestdio.h

#includemath.h

main(? ?)

{

float a = 1.4, b = -2.7 ;

printf("%f的絕對值是%f,%f的絕對值是%f\n", a, fabs( a ), b, fabs( b ));

}

運行結果為:1.400000的絕對值是1.400000,-2.700000的絕對值是2.700000

擴展資料:

其他math.h頭文件包含函數介紹:

1、 三角函數

double sin(double);正弦

double cos(double);余弦

double tan(double);正切

2 、反三角函數

double asin (double); 結果介于[-PI/2,PI/2]

double acos (double); 結果介于[0,PI]

double atan (double); 反正切(主值),結果介于[-PI/2,PI/2]

double atan2 (double,double); 反正切(整圓值),結果介于[-PI,PI]

3 、雙曲三角函數

double sinh (double);

double cosh (double);

double tanh (double);

4 、指數與對數

double frexp(double value,int *exp);這是一個將value值拆分成小數部分f和(以2為底的)指數部分exp,并返回小數部分f,即f*2^exp。其中f取值在0.5~1.0范圍或者0。

double ldexp(double x,int exp);這個函數剛好跟上面那個frexp函數功能相反,它的返回值是x*2^exp

double modf(double value,double *iptr);拆分value值,返回它的小數部分,iptr指向整數部分。

double log (double); 以e為底的對數

double log10 (double);以10為底的對數

double pow(double x,double y);計算x的y次冪

float powf(float x,float y); 功能與pow一致,只是輸入與輸出皆為單精度浮點數

double exp (double);求取自然數e的冪

double sqrt (double);開平方根

5 、取整

double ceil (double); 取上整,返回不比x小的最小整數

double floor (double); 取下整,返回不比x大的最大整數,即高斯函數[x]

c語言分段函數的值

輸入數用scanf()函數;

分段用switch()函數;

1、絕對值用math庫里面的abs()函數

2、e^x用math庫里面的pow(e,x)函數

3、同理指數的都有pow()函數,

4、cos函數也是math庫里面的double cos(double x)函數

補充:對于自變量x的不同的取值范圍,有著不同的對應法則,這樣的函數通常叫做分段函數。它是一個函數,而不是幾個函數;分段函數的定義域是各段函數定義域的并集,值域也是各段函數值域的并集。

本文標題:c語言計算分段函數絕對值 計算某數的絕對值c語言
網址分享:http://m.kartarina.com/article0/hgjcoo.html

成都網站建設公司_創新互聯,為您提供定制開發網站排名、用戶體驗、網站營銷靜態網站、Google

廣告

聲明:本網站發布的內容(圖片、視頻和文字)以用戶投稿、用戶轉載內容為主,如果涉及侵權請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網站立場,如需處理請聯系客服。電話:028-86922220;郵箱:631063699@qq.com。內容未經允許不得轉載,或轉載時需注明來源: 創新互聯

網站建設網站維護公司
主站蜘蛛池模板: 人妻丰满熟妇AV无码片| 久久久久亚洲AV成人无码| 一本大道无码日韩精品影视| mm1313亚洲国产精品无码试看| 亚洲AV永久无码精品一区二区国产 | 无码人妻精品一区二区蜜桃| 在线精品自拍无码| 一本久道综合在线无码人妻 | 亚洲av无码成人精品区在线播放| 无码精品一区二区三区免费视频 | 午夜无码视频一区二区三区| 无码国产色欲XXXXX视频| 国产精品第一区揄拍无码| 亚洲日韩精品A∨片无码加勒比| 在线观看片免费人成视频无码 | 国产综合无码一区二区三区| 人妻丰满熟AV无码区HD| 中文字幕精品三区无码亚洲| 久久久久无码国产精品一区| 自慰无码一区二区三区| 色综合色国产热无码一| 亚洲成a人无码亚洲成av无码| 亚洲国产精品无码中文字| 亚洲中文字幕无码中文字在线| 好爽毛片一区二区三区四无码三飞 | 欧洲精品久久久av无码电影| 国产成人无码区免费网站| 亚洲国产综合无码一区二区二三区| 国产成年无码久久久久下载| 亚洲精品无码成人| 精品久久久久久久无码久中文字幕 | 国产午夜无码视频在线观看| 永久免费AV无码网站国产 | 韩日美无码精品无码| 一区二区三区人妻无码| 国产品无码一区二区三区在线蜜桃| 自慰无码一区二区三区| 久久久无码中文字幕久... | 成人无码一区二区三区| 久久亚洲AV永久无码精品| 成人av片无码免费天天看|